Bravo fans are living for the moment Real Housewives of Atlanta gave us all the drama we needed. During Sunday’s episode, Cynthia Bailey finally reached her breaking point after Shamea Morton and Kelli Ferrell wouldn’t stop complaining about their accommodations during the cast trip to Dallas. And honestly? The internet is here for it.
When Real Housewives of Atlanta viewers watched this unfold, they couldn’t help but celebrate Cynthia’s no-nonsense energy. Shamea and Kelli had been expressing frustration about being placed in the pool house, claiming the room was dirty when they arrived. Cynthia apologized and promised to have the space cleaned. But the complaints kept coming, and honestly, we felt her exhaustion.
“Pinky said you guys were like dragging me about the whole situation,” Cynthia said while confronting the group during a tense moment.
Shamea wasn’t backing down. “You did say you were going to send someone over, but it didn’t get cleaned, and nothing happened.”
Cynthia eventually lost her patience with the repeated criticism. “I’m doing the best that I can do!” she said, and the room—both on screen and in group chats everywhere—felt that energy.
The exchange escalated quickly. Kelli began discussing comfort and expectations while traveling, which drew Drew Sidora into the argument. Before long, things got personal.
“And you look like the alien in your movie,” Kelli told Drew after tensions flared.
Cynthia shut it all the way down. “This is not a hostage situation. If you don’t want to be here, leave,” she said firmly. “I do not want to hear anything else about this room being dirty.”
In a confessional, Shamea joked, “I met the one from Power who don’t play that s–t.” And the internet absolutely agreed—this was the kind of statement piece moment that reminds us why we watch reality TV in the first place.
Viewers praised Cynthia for the way she handled the situation. Honestly, we were all tired of hearing Shamea and Kelli complain and mope about their accommodations. The social media response was swift and decisive, with fans making it clear that Cynthia had every right to set boundaries and keep the peace during what should’ve been a fun trip.
